    "Meh"

    You can quote me here if I turn out to be wrong, but I see this flopping.

    I just don't see very many people that would buy this over an iPad... Those that are anti-iPad are those that just don't want/need a tablet. There can't be many people out there that will say, "well I'll buy a tablet PC now because BB finally made one with a USB port" (those people are missing the point of what the tablets are for anyway, it's not meant to replace your main computer/laptop).

    RIM got leap frogged in the phone market and I see this and their new Torch phone as hail marys trying to catch up to things that Apple already made popular. There will always be anti-Apple people, but they are buying Androids now (at least most former BB users I know).
